The Symbol of Unity in a Fragmented World
Understanding the Context
The flag of the Holy Roman Empire was more than just a banner; it was a visual declaration of imperial authority, tradition, and continuity. Though no single standardized design existed — a reflection of the Empire’s decentralized nature — the most recognized version featured a black double-headed eagle on a white or golden field. Often surrounded by rays or inscribed with imperial colors, the imagery conveyed both divine sanction and imperial sovereignty.
Historically, the black eagle became associated with the Empire during the 13th century under Emperor Frederick II and solidified its place under later ruling houses. Its regal and imposing design symbolized strength, vigilance, and the unbroken line of imperial legitimacy dating back to Charlemagne. Yet despite this iconic imagery, the flag’s appearance varied across regions and reigns — a testament to the Empire’s complexity rather than inconsistency.
Myths and Misconceptions
One enduring myth surrounding the Holy Roman Empire’s flag is that it bore a specific, universally recognized design. In reality, the absence of a fixed flag highlights the Empire’s decentralized identity. Each crown-state often adopted its own heraldic symbols, yet all remained under the overarching imperial banner during key ceremonies or documents. The flag’s mythology grew over time, molded by romanticized histories and nationalist movements in the 19th century, which elevated the Empire’s symbolic power despite its political reality.

Another misconception is that the flag vanished forever after the Empire’s dissolution in 1806. Truthfully, its legacy never truly faded. The double-headed eagle descended into modern heraldry, appearing in national and regional symbols across Central Europe, and the imperial imagery continues to inspire cultural and historical narratives today.
A Legacy Never Meant to Disappear
Far from being a relic of bygone days, the Holy Roman Empire’s flag endures as a powerful symbol of European heritage. Its black eagle—shrouded in centuries of myth and meaning—embodies the enduring spirit of a political experiment that defied simplicity. It stood not as a standard of a fully integrated state, but as a recognition of unity in diversity.
Though the Empire dissolved centuries ago, its flag remains a cornerstone of historical imagination — a reminder that some symbols outlive their original purpose, preserved by memory, myth, and an unyielding legacy.
